Baghdad (IraqiNews.com) The Foreign Relations Parliamentary Committee called upon the Ministry of Foreign Affairs to follow up the case of the murder of a young Iraqi for racist motivations in Greece.

MP Rafi Abd al-Jabbar, a member of the Committee, told Iraqi News (IraqiNews.com) Monday that “The Committee will ask the Ministry of Foreign Affairs to follow up the murder of a young Iraqi man in Greece at the hands of unknown persons due to racist motivations and to address the official Greek authorities to investigate the incident and bring the killers for justice.”

He added that “The Foreign Ministry is serious in its work to follow up such cases for Iraqi nationals and Iraqi refugees all over the world.”

The Greek police announced last Saturday the death of a young Iraqi citizen in Athens due to an attack committed by five unidentified armed men by using knives.

The initial investigations indicated that “Racist motives practiced by some groups against the foreign nationals are behind the crime.”
